Takatenjin Castle

This mountain castle, located in Kakegawa City (formerly Daito Town) in Shizuoka Prefecture, dates back to the Sengoku period and was the site of fierce battles between Tokugawa Ieyasu and Takeda Katsuyori. Built on Mt. Tsuruo, which is 132 meters above sea level, it was known as an "impregnable castle" due to its natural fortress.
The castle ruins are now a hiking trail and
are popular with history buffs and castle enthusiasts.
